Former US Presidential Candidate: Young voters turn to Trump, economy and peace become key factors
According to CNN, former presidential candidate and Trump supporter Vivek Ramaswamy said that Trump's campaign attracted more traditionally Democratic-supporting groups, including African Americans, Hispanics, and Generation Z voters. Ramaswamy pointed out that Gen Z voters are mainly concerned with avoiding involvement in foreign conflicts, preventing a "third world war", promoting economic growth and reducing housing costs.
Ramaswamy emphasized: "If the United States unfortunately gets involved in a foreign war, Generation Z will be the first to bear the brunt. In addition, prices have risen in recent years while wage growth has not kept up." When asked whether Trump should admit defeat if he loses the election, Ramaswamy said: "Whoever wins the election should win; losers should admit failure."
